DRDO Successfully Tests Indigenous Long Range Land Attack Cruise Missile

India's defence capabilities received a boost with the successful flight-test of an advanced indigenous cruise missile, marking a significant step in self-reliance.

Summary of News

The Defence Research and Development Organisation (DRDO) successfully conducted a flight-test of an indigenous Long Range Land Attack Cruise Missile (LR-LAC) from a test facility in Odisha. This advanced missile demonstrated its capabilities in a crucial developmental trial. The DRDO has been working on enhancing India's missile technology, and this test is part of ongoing efforts to strengthen the nation's defence infrastructure. The LR-LAC missile is designed to strike targets deep within enemy territory with high precision. This successful test validates the missile's design and operational parameters, bringing it closer to induction into the armed forces. The DRDO continues to focus on developing cutting-edge defence technologies to ensure national security.

Important Keywords Explained
DRDOorganization

The Defence Research and Development Organisation (DRDO) is an agency of the Government of India, responsible for the development of defence technologies, systems, and products. It was founded in 1958 and is headquartered in New Delhi. DRDO works under the Ministry of Defence and plays a crucial role in making India self-reliant in defence.

Cruise Missileconcept

A cruise missile is a guided missile that remains within the atmosphere and flies the major portion of its flight path at approximately constant speed. It is typically designed to deliver a large warhead over long distances with high accuracy. Unlike ballistic missiles, cruise missiles fly at lower altitudes and can maneuver to avoid detection.

Land Attack Cruise Missileconcept

A Land Attack Cruise Missile (LACM) is a type of cruise missile specifically designed to strike targets on land. These missiles are often launched from air, sea, or land platforms and can follow terrain-hugging flight paths to evade radar detection, delivering precision strikes against fixed or moving ground targets.

Additional Facts & Context
1DRDO operates over 50 laboratories across India.
2India's Integrated Guided Missile Development Programme (IGMDP) was launched in 1983.
3The BrahMos is a supersonic cruise missile developed jointly by India and Russia.
4Odisha's Chandipur Integrated Test Range is a key missile testing site in India.
